Output 95eac3bd3530885985ad01d7650922e6064fafc284f184c5fb51df2559c767fa:0

value
16083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c6174c9aae68e60f0b548938670fad143f9507 OP_EQUAL
address
3MBMA1Snt8ugEoqPXmZzLfVdcQGRZFpMc4
transaction
95eac3bd3530885985ad01d7650922e6064fafc284f184c5fb51df2559c767fa
spent
true